The power of Product Lifecycle Management Australasia’s new NX Nastran solver and Femap 9 CAD/CAE integrator strategy helps mine engineers effectively conduct finite and stress analysis on equipment and associated structures.
NX Nastran for Femap can successfully analyse general mining and materials handling items – hoppers, stackers, reclaimers, bins, large buildings – and the vibrations that these and other machines cause.
The software is useful for determining vibration characteristics of buildings and equipment, and to determine stresses, deflections and accelerations when subject to static and dynamic loads.
This helps determine areas where existing equipment wants strengthening to prolong life, and prevent cracking and early failure.

According to plm, the integrator strategy allows Femap to create 3D models as a stand-alone modeller or to import most CAD models and formats. Exceptional FE modelling and result post processing capabilities make Femap a suitable choice in mining and materials handling.
With the integrator strategy, Femap can communicate with many CAE solvers.
NX Nastran is based on MSC.Nastran and can support a range of commonly used engineering simulations: linear static structural analysis, non-linear structural analysis, inertia relief, normal modes for vibration, structural buckling, composites, basic fluid flow interaction, and steady state and transient heat transfer.
